[0013] The embodiment of the present invention is characterized in that according to the characteristics of sea tide fluctuations, after several times of seawater immersion, it develops into an adult. The concrete steps of the embodiment of the present invention are as follows:

[0014] 1. Breeding in the nursery stage: select mature, healthy, complete and responsive male and female parents for artificial insemination, and then put the fertilized eggs into a bucket filled with seawater for cultivation. In order to prevent the fertilized eggs from sinking to the bottom from hypoxia, the The fertilized eggs of the fertilized eggs will be stirred frequently during the development period, and grow into larvae after 3-5 days, that is, when 3 pairs of feet grow, at this time, the algae (such as spirulina, etc.) are used as bait for further cultivation;

A method for raising clam worm includes such steps as choosing health parents, artificial fertilization, putting the fertilized ova in the seawater contained in drum, supplying seaweed (such as spirulina) as feed to culture larvae until the larva has 5-6 pairs of legs, culturing in spool in water flowing mode for 10 days while supplying seaweed and fish powder as feed, culturing in water exchanging mode while supplying fish powder as feed, and culturing in water bath while supplying seaweed and fish powder as feed.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a method for cultivating clam worms. Background technique [0002] Nereid worms belong to the phylum Annelida and class Polychaetes, also known as sea leeches, sea worms, sea centipedes, etc. Nereist worm is the main bait for marine fish, shrimp, turtle, shellfish, etc. It can also be used as an excellent additive and food attractant for eel and other special aquatic products. The lugworms in the breeding period are delicious and nutritious, and contain more unsaturated fatty acid-eicosapentaenoic acid (EPA), which has the functions of regulating blood lipids, preventing cardiovascular and cerebrovascular diseases, lowering blood pressure, nourishing yin deficiency, and calming cough and asthma.
